    Cosmological applications in Kaluza-Klein theory

    The field equations of Kaluza-Klein (KK) theory have been applied in the domain of cosmology. These equations are solved for a flat universe by taking the gravitational and the cosmological constants as a function of time t. We use Taylor's expansion of cosmological function, Λ(t)\Lambda(t), up to the first order of the time tt.
